This is a superb large French porcelain hand painted and gilded Apothecary Jar and cover which dates, I would guess, from the late 18th. In a cylindrical form topped with a knopped conical cover, decorated with copious hand painted gilded images of a foliate swags, the Caduceus (two snakes wrapped around a winged staff), and what looks to be a mortar above, and gilded banding throughout.
